Serpoje
Serpoje, known officially as the Republic of Serpoje, is an island nation located in the Southern Sea. It is bordered by Biaten to the northwest, Thromsa to the north, Razzgriz to the east, Corindia to the southeast and Sawneeak Atoll to the west. About 94 percent of the country’s citizens are ethnically Serpojian whilst the largest minority are the Meheratis at about 3% of the total population. Bolu is the capital city of the nation and its largest city (804,324) followed by the cities of Gerede, Yeni Çağ and Göynük respectively.

Geograpy


Serpoje covers an area of 31,021 km2. The highest point in the nation is Uludag Peak at 1,352m above sea level near the eastern mountains and drops to its lowest point where the land meets the West Sea at 0m above sea level. Serpoje predominantly has a warm-summer Mediterranean climate (Csa on the Koppen-Geiger scale) and in the cooler months is effected heavily by humid westerly winds. The temperature, especially in summer, exceeds 19°C. Winters are mild but can feel quite cool because of the windchill whilst summers are often very hot and dry. Serpoje has an outstanding environment with habitat diversity and strong ecosystems enabling a significant number of species to be found in the country. Many plants on the island are native to it and are used for agricultural purposes.

Politics


Serpoje is a presidential republic with a parliament being the major legislative body. The system itself is largely based on the Constitution which was announced in 1927, which has become known as the Mekhebi. The Serpoje National Forces consist of Land Forces, Navy and Air Force. Serpojians are subject to a national service program, requiring some of its citizens to perform military service by the age of 25. However, this requirement is planned to be lifted. The National Forces are controlled by the President. Currently, there are 1000 personnel actively employed, 4000 volunteer personnel and 8,500 active reserve forces.

Demographics


According to the data obtained as a result of the population registration system, as of April 29, 2019, Serpoje has a population of 8 million 863 thousand 214 people. This figure was 2.6 million in 1931, when the first official census was conducted. 87.4% of the population live in provincial and district centers. According to the same data, an average of 98 people per km2 falls in Serpoje. 70.9% of the population are in the 15-64 age group and 22.6% are in the 0-14 age group. About 8.5% are people aged 65 and over. The most developed and most populous city of Serpoje is Bolu. The ethnic origin of the vast majority of the country is Serpojians. According to research, although many ethnic groups live in Serpoje, including Karhanuts, Gehens, Arabs, Circassians, Gypsies, the only officially recognized minorities in the country are Kurds, Meheratis and Koferians. The official language of Serpoje is Turkish, which is also the mother tongue of 94% of the population. About 3% of the population speaks Meheratian language as their first language.

Edudaction


Pre-university education in serpoje is under the supervision of the Ministry of Education of the Republic of Serpoje. A total of 12 years of education, including 4 years of Primary School, 4 years of Secondary School and 4 years of high school, is compulsory and free of charge. As of 2019 in serpoje, 99.2% of the adult population is literate; the literacy rate within the male population is 98.2% while the literacy rate within the female population is 97.3%. As of 2019, the number of universities in Serpoje is 19. In the country, there is no concept of a" private school", and all schools are dependent on the state.

Economy


Serpoje's economy is dominated by the service sector, which includes the agricultural sector, trade, tourism and industry. The income earned by the tourism sector in 2011 was $ 200 million, but industry contributes 20% of GDP and agriculture 11%. Serpoje uses Johena as its currency. Other important parts of Serpoje's economy are fishing, construction, taxation, textiles, oil, food, mining.
Only 22% of the working population is made up of women, according to 2012 data. In serpoje, the income of the richest segment is 7.6 times that of the poorest segment. 13% of the population is below the poverty line.
